--- Comment #1 from Krzysztof Nowicki <kri...@op.pl> ---
Exchange categories contain far less metadata compared to Akonadi tags. On the
Exchange side there is only a name and colour. This was the main reason why the
EWS resource only does one-way synchronization of tags into categories. It
writes the full Akonadi metadata into custom attributes and only sets the
category name corresponding to the Akonadi tag name.
The problem with reverse synchronization is that on Akonadi side it is
perfectly possible to have multiple tags with identical name - they will just
have a different internal identifier. In such case the conversion from Exchange
(just name) into Akonadi would be ambiguous. It would also be unclear what to
do in case an Exchange category is retrieved, that doesn't have an Akonadi tag
with a corresponding name.
I agree that it would be possible to come up with a set of conversion rules and
allow limited reverse sync (Exchange -> Akonadi).
